About Event

A founder-first gathering with investors and partners in fintech innovation.

Join us for a light breakfast bringing together founders, investors, and ecosystem partners at the intersection of fintech innovation and global expansion. With founders at the heart of the conversation, this gathering welcomes those building in the U.S. as well as those expanding across borders. It’s designed to spark ideas, build relationships, and create meaningful dialogue that fuels growth.

Whether you’re scaling in NYC, growing across the U.S., or expanding internationally, the breakfast connects diverse perspectives within the global fintech ecosystem, inspiring collaboration and new opportunities.

🥐 Start your morning fueled by ideas and connections over a light breakfast. No panels, no pitches, no speakers. Just meaningful conversations with peers.
